Description of the PR
Split each API method in half to add a public facing
_operation_RequestOptions()
method. The purpose of this method is to queue everything up ready to execute, but not actually execute it.This allows the user to intercept the request, make modifications, and execute it on their own. This is useful (for example) when you want to use a WebSockets protocol that nonetheless re-uses all of the auth and everything else from a RESTful API, or when a RESTful API has some methods that return raw streams of data instead of JSON.
